#381440 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#381440 is composed of 22% red, 7.8% green and 25.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 12.5% cyan, 68.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 74.9% black. It has a hue angle of 289.1 degrees, a saturation of 52.4% and a lightness of 16.5%. #381440 color hex could be obtained by blending #702880 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330033.

#381440 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#381440 has RGB values of R:56, G:20, B:64 and CMYK values of C:0.13, M:0.69, Y:0, K:0.75. Its decimal value is 3675200.
